『壹』 計算機內,配置高速緩沖存儲器(CACHE)是為了解決什麼
B,CPU與內存儲器之間速度不匹配問題。
高速緩沖存儲器(Cache)其原始意義是指存取速度比一般隨機存取記憶體(RAM)來得快的一種RAM,一般而言它不像系統主記憶體那樣使用DRAM技術,而使用昂貴但較快速的SRAM技術,也有快取記憶體的名稱。
高速緩沖存儲器是存在於主存與CPU之間的一級存儲器, 由靜態存儲晶元(SRAM)組成,容量比較小但速度比主存高得多, 接近於CPU的速度。在計算機存儲系統的層次結構中,是介於中央處理器和主存儲器之間的高速小容量存儲器。它和主存儲器一起構成一級的存儲器。高速緩沖存儲器和主存儲器之間信息的調度和傳送是由硬體自動進行的。
(1)高速緩沖存儲器怎麼解擴展閱讀:
高速緩沖存儲器組成結構
高速緩沖存儲器是存在於主存與CPU之間的一級存儲器, 由靜態存儲晶元(SRAM)組成,容量比較小但速度比主存高得多, 接近於CPU的速度。
主要由三大部分組成:
1、Cache存儲體:存放由主存調入的指令與數據塊。
2、地址轉換部件:建立目錄表以實現主存地址到緩存地址的轉換。
3、替換部件:在緩存已滿時按一定策略進行數據塊替換,並修改地址轉換部件。
『貳』 微型計算機配置高速緩沖存儲器是為了解決什麼
微型計算機配置高速緩沖存儲器是為了解決內存緩存。
高速緩沖器一般理解為緩存通常處理器內部的L1L2LL3就是說的這個,屬於位於CPU與內存之間的臨時存儲器,它的容量比內存小但交換速度快。
在緩存中的數據是內存中的一小部分,但這一小部分是短時間內CPU即將訪問的,當CPU調用大量數據時,就可避開內存直接從緩存中調用,從而加快讀取速度。
由此可見,在CPU中加入緩存是一種高效的解決方案,這樣整個內存儲器(緩存+內存)就變成了既有緩存的高速度,又有內存的大容量的存儲系統了。
高速緩沖存儲器分輸入緩沖器和輸出緩沖器兩種。前者的作用是將外設送來的數據暫時存放,以便處理器將它取走;後者的作用是用來暫時存放處理器送往外設的數據。
有了緩沖器,就可以使高速工作的CPU與慢速工作的外設起協調和緩沖作用,實現數據傳送的同步。由於緩沖器接在數據匯流排上,故必須具有三態輸出功能。
(2)高速緩沖存儲器怎麼解擴展閱讀:
在計算機技術發展過程中,主存儲器存取速度一直比中央處理器操作速度慢得多,使中央處理器的高速處理能力不能充分發揮,整個計算機系統的工作效率受到影響。有很多方法可用來緩和中央處理器和主存儲器之間速度不匹配的矛盾。
如採用多個通用寄存器、多存儲體交叉存取等,在存儲層次上採用高速緩沖存儲器也是常用的方法之一。很多大、中型計算機以及新近的一些小型機、微型機也都採用高速緩沖存儲器。
高速緩沖存儲器的容量一般只有主存儲器的幾百分之一,但它的存取速度能與中央處理器相匹配。根據程序局部性原理,正在使用的主存儲器某一單元鄰近的那些單元將被用到的可能性很大。
因而,當中央處理器存取主存儲器某一單元時,計算機硬體就自動地將包括該單元在內的那一組單元內容調入高速緩沖存儲器,中央處理器即將存取的主存儲器單元很可能就在剛剛調入到高速緩沖存儲器的那一組單元內。
於是,中央處理器就可以直接對高速緩沖存儲器進行存取。在整個處理過程中,如果中央處理器絕大多數存取主存儲器的操作能為存取高速緩沖存儲器所代替,計算機系統處理速度就能顯著提高。
『叄』 名詞解釋 高速緩沖存儲器
高速緩沖存儲器(Cache)其原始意義是指存取速度比一般隨機存取記憶體(RAM)來得快的一種RAM,一般而言它不像系統主記憶體那樣使用DRAM技術,而使用昂貴但較快速的SRAM技術,也有快取記憶體的名稱。在計算機存儲系統的層次結構中,介於中央處理器和主存儲器之間的高速小容量存儲器。它和主存儲器一起構成一級的存儲器。高速緩沖存儲器和主存儲器之間信息的調度和傳送是由硬體自動進行的。
『肆』 配置高速緩沖存儲器Cache是為了解決什麼問題
CPU速度最快,高速緩存次之,下來就是內存,硬碟等的普通存儲設備,所以是平衡和內存的速度不匹配引入的技術,
『伍』 什麼是高速緩沖存儲器為什麼要設置高速緩沖存儲器
高速緩沖存儲器一般由高速SRAM構成,這種局部存儲器是面向CPU的,引入它是為減小或消除CPU與內存之間的速度差異對系統性能帶來的影響。
廣義來說,計算機內部存儲器包括硬碟,內存,高速緩存,其中主要的存儲器是硬碟它存儲著操作系統需要的大部分數據,但是他讀寫速度慢,因而引入了內存,作為系統和硬碟之間的緩沖,這樣CPU不用頻繁訪問速度慢的硬碟。我們知道後來CPU速度發展遠遠快於內存,後來又引入了高速緩存,是為了緩解CPU和內存速度不匹配的問題。
『陸』 高速緩沖存儲器CACHE的問題
1985年春天的時候,英特爾公司已經成為了第一流的晶元公司,它決心全力開發新一代的32位核心的CPU—80386。Intel給80386設計了三個技術要點:使用「類286」結構,開發80387微處理器增強浮點運算能力,開發高速緩存解決內存速度瓶頸。
1985年10月17日,英特爾發布了劃時代的產品——80386DX,其內部包含27.5萬個晶體管,時鍾頻率為12.5MHz,後逐步提高到20MHz、25MHz、33MHz,最後還有少量的40MHz產品。針對內存的速度瓶頸,英特爾為80386設計了高速緩存(Cache),採取預讀內存的方法來緩解這個速度瓶頸,從此以後,Cache就和CPU成為了如影隨形的東西。
1993年,Intel從Pentium 586開始將Cache分開,通常分為一級高速緩存L1和二級高速緩存L2。
1999年春節剛過,英特爾公司就發布了採用Katmai核心的新一代微處理器—PentiumⅢ,內置32KB一級緩存和512KB二級緩存。
在以往的觀念中,L1 Cache是集成在CPU中的,被稱為片內Cache。在L1中還分數據Cache(I-Cache)和指令Cache(D-Cache)。它們分別用來存放數據和執行這些數據的指令,而且兩個Cache可以同時被CPU訪問,減少了爭用Cache所造成的沖突,提高了處理器效能。
以前的L2 Cache沒集成在CPU中,而在主板上或與CPU集成在同一塊電路板上,因此也被稱為片外Cache。但從PⅢ開始,由於工藝的提高L2 Cache被集成在CPU內核中,以相同於主頻的速度工作,結束了L2 Cache與CPU大差距分頻的歷史,使L2 Cache與L1 Cache在性能上平等,得到更高的傳輸速度。
『柒』 解釋高速緩沖存儲器(Cache)的作用是什麼
緩沖存儲器
就好比
一個快捷方式
把你經常用到的程序自動記憶(如QQ.下載工具等)
分一級二級現在還出了三級緩存
下次你還用上次的程序的話
緩存直接讀取硬碟內容
不用經過內存
而減少內存的資源
賽揚處理
的緩存都比較低
建議用
酷睿
『捌』 配置高速緩沖存儲器是為了解決
c
3.配置高速緩沖存儲器(Cache)是為了解決( )。C
A、內存與輔助存儲器之間速度不匹配問題 B、CPU與輔助存儲器之間速度不匹配問題
C、CPU與內存儲器之間速度不匹配問題 D、主機與外設之間速度不匹配問題
『玖』 配置高速緩沖存儲器是為了解決什麼問題
高速緩存的出現就是因為處理器的高速讀取數據的速度比內存儲器的工作速度快太多.高速緩存是一種比處理器慢比內存快介於二者之間的一種儲存裝置